Compare Bartlett to Gallatin
This post compares Bartlett, Tennessee to Gallatin, Tennessee across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Bartlett (city) | Gallatin (city) |
---|---|---|
Population | 58,640 | 34,495 |
Income (median) | $55,362 | $40,679 |
Home Value (median) | $172,300 | $172,700 |
White | 72% | 80% |
Black | 21% | 12% |
Asian | 2% | 1% |
With Kids | 33% | 33% |
Age (median) | 42 | 37 |
Rentals | 15% | 40% |
